EXCEEDS logo
Exceeds
Guste Gaubaite

PROFILE

Guste Gaubaite

Guste Gaubaite developed and refined interactive UI components for the Lemoncode/quickmock repository, focusing on scalable features such as FileTree, MobilePhoneShape, and advanced shape systems. She applied React and TypeScript to implement dynamic sizing, real-time updates, and responsive layouts, integrating SVG assets and optimizing component boundaries for maintainability. Her work included robust test automation using Playwright and unit testing, as well as code refactoring to improve performance and reduce re-renders. By consolidating utilities and enhancing documentation, Guste enabled faster iteration and clearer migration paths, delivering a more consistent user experience and a stable, extensible codebase for future development.

Overall Statistics

Feature vs Bugs

91%Features

Repository Contributions

90Total
Bugs
2
Commits
90
Features
21
Lines of code
3,626
Activity Months6

Work History

October 2025

9 Commits • 2 Features

Oct 1, 2025

October 2025 performance and reliability summary for Lemoncode/quickmock: Key features delivered include File Tree Component Sizing, Layout, and Performance Enhancements, with dynamic width calculation to prevent icon overflow, improved resize behavior for content and ElementSize changes, support for manual height resizing, extraction of interfaces into a dedicated model file, and memoization to reduce re-renders. Also shipped SelectSize v2 Migration Documentation to guide upcoming changes. Major bugs fixed include parsing edge cases for symbols with spaces, and lowering minHeight constraints to enable proper width resizing, eliminating empty space. Overall impact: sharper UI responsiveness, fewer render cycles, improved stability and maintainability, and clearer migration guidance for users. Technologies/skills demonstrated: React hooks (useFileTreeResize), performance optimization via memoization, robust parsing logic, unit testing coverage for parseFileTreeText, refactoring to dedicated model files, and included documentation.

September 2025

24 Commits • 6 Features

Sep 1, 2025

Monthly summary for 2025-09 — Lemoncode/quickmock: Delivered a cohesive FileTree feature set with dynamic content handling and a scalable sizing system, significantly improving UI consistency and developer velocity. Implemented the core FileTree component and integrated it with canvas rendering and the gallery, enabling reliable shape configuration and inline editing. Enabled dynamic parsing, multiline indentation, and dynamic height for FileTree content, reducing manual layout work. Created and updated FileTree SVG assets to provide consistent visuals across states. Established a sizing and shape system with a generic size model and SelectSizeV2, standardizing font and icon dimensions across all file-tree variants. Fixed critical UX issues including selection bounds and text overflow, ensuring a robust editing experience. These changes improve editor UX, enable faster UI iteration, and lay groundwork for scalable theming and component parity.

August 2025

7 Commits • 3 Features

Aug 1, 2025

August 2025 – Lemoncode/quickmock focused on delivering high-impact UI improvements and a maintainability boost. Key features delivered include MobilePhoneShape visual enhancements with status/icons, a real-time clock, time adorner, and layout improvements for better realism and responsiveness; a refactored SVG icon utilities layer (svg.utils.ts) used by icon-shape and fab-button to improve consistency; and TimePicker/UI alignment improvements to standardize heights and text positioning. Major fixes addressed UI glitches such as time display orientation (right-to-left) and min-width issues to ensure stable layouts at small viewports. Impact: richer, more realistic UI and improved user experience, reduced UI defects, and faster future iterations enabled by shared utilities and clearer component boundaries. Technologies/skills demonstrated include React/TypeScript component design, SVG handling and refactoring, UI/UX alignment, and responsive layout techniques.

July 2025

23 Commits • 5 Features

Jul 1, 2025

July 2025 focused on strengthening test coverage and reliability for Lemoncode/quickmock, delivering a robust thumb-based testing layer, expanding UI testing utilities, and integrating new shape system components. Key outcomes include feature-rich thumb testing capabilities, expanded UI testing for thumb page interactions, reusable testing helpers, and FAB integration into the shape system. A targeted fix addressed intermittent duplication test flakiness to improve stability of the end-to-end test suite, contributing to faster, more reliable release validation.

May 2025

10 Commits • 3 Features

May 1, 2025

May 2025 performance summary: Delivered two high-impact feature sets across Lemoncode/quickmock and Lemoncode/gex-front, with a focus on business value and maintainability. Key outcomes include a full Paragraph Scribbled Shape feature with renderer, core-model integration, canvas rendering, path calculation, constants, gallery data, and an SVG asset, plus a redesigned TableHeader component integrated into TableComponent to enable sort-by and a new certification action. Also performed targeted UI cleanup to reduce clutter in EditarCertificaciones. Result: richer UX, cleaner architecture, and reusable assets that accelerate future work.

April 2025

17 Commits • 2 Features

Apr 1, 2025

April 2025 performance summary for Lemoncode/quickmock. This period focused on feature delivery with a strong emphasis on visual fidelity and developer experience. No major bugs were reported as the month’s work centered on introducing new capabilities and UI refinements, followed by thorough testing. The efforts deliver business value through more accurate rendering, easier customization, and improved maintainability. Technologies demonstrated include TypeScript typings for shape dimensions, UI panel integration, and robust test coverage.

Activity

Loading activity data...

Quality Metrics

Correctness96.0%
Maintainability95.6%
Architecture93.6%
Performance92.6%
AI Usage21.0%

Skills & Technologies

Programming Languages

CSSJavaScriptSVGTypeScripttsx

Technical Skills

Asset CreationAsset IntegrationAsset ManagementAutomationCSS ModulesCode OptimizationCode OrganizationCode RefactoringComponent DesignComponent DevelopmentComponent IntegrationComponent Library ManagementComponent ManagementComponent StylingComponent Testing

Repositories Contributed To

2 repos

Overview of all repositories you've contributed to across your timeline

Lemoncode/quickmock

Apr 2025 Oct 2025
6 Months active

Languages Used

CSSJavaScriptSVGTypeScripttsx

Technical Skills

Asset ManagementCode OptimizationComponent DesignComponent ManagementConfiguration ManagementFront End Development

Lemoncode/gex-front

May 2025 May 2025
1 Month active

Languages Used

CSSJavaScriptTypeScript

Technical Skills

Component DevelopmentFront-end DevelopmentFrontend DevelopmentMaterial-UIReactTypeScript

Generated by Exceeds AIThis report is designed for sharing and indexing